The LTE-V2X demonstration application project is launched, and the world's first urban-level vehicle-road collaboration platform has entered a comprehensive implementation stage

On May 3, the launch meeting of the major project of the Internet of Vehicles (LTE-V2X) urban-level demonstration application was held in Wuxi. The conference completed the formal signing of the Wuxi car networking city-level demonstration application project, and unveiled the work group of the major vehicle-level demonstration application project of the Internet of Vehicles (LTE-V2X), which means the world's first city-level vehicle-road collaboration platform Enter the stage of full implementation.

In September 2017, the Ministry of Industry and Information Technology, the Ministry of Public Security, and the People ’s Government of Jiangsu Province jointly built a national comprehensive test base for intelligent transportation in Wuxi. The LTE-V2X Internet of Vehicles application test on a small scale was also unveiled during last year ’s Expo These have laid a good foundation for the development of Wuxi car networking applications. Combined with the advantages of the early development of Internet of Vehicles, the Wuxi Municipal Government and China Mobile, the Ministry of Public Security Traffic Management Research Institute, Huawei, the Wuxi Municipal Public Security Bureau Traffic Police Detachment, China Information and Communication Research Institute, Jiangsu Tianan Zhilian and other parties have gone through many in-depth After discussions and exchanges, it was decided to launch the LTE-V2X project in Wuxi, and today officially launched the construction of a large-scale urban-level Internet of Vehicles application.

It is reported that the planned implementation time of the project is from 2017 to the end of 2020, and the scale application of Wuxi intelligent connected vehicles will be realized in three phases:

1. The first phase of the project mainly carried out open road test research, collected and completed demonstration samples, which have basically been achieved, and also demonstrated during the 2017 World Expo;

2. The second phase of the project will realize city-level demonstration application, that is, the project officially launched in Wuxi today, will form a city-level scale application in Wuxi, which is planned to be completed in September 2018 (before this year's Expo will be held) to cover Wuxi There are 211 intersections and 5 elevated roads in the old city, Taihu New City, high-speed rail station, airport, Xuelang test site, etc., which serve 100,000 social vehicles.

After the completion of this phase of the project, typical application scenarios such as traffic light information push, speed guidance, ambulance priority access reminder, road event situation reminder, and tidal lane will be implemented in relevant road areas. This also makes full use of the global scheduling capabilities of the Internet of Vehicles platform, which can optimize the urban transportation system and enhance citizens' travel perception. The project implementation results will be officially unveiled to the public during the World Internet of Things Expo held in September 2018;

3. The third phase of the project will further build Wuxi into the nation's first Internet of Vehicles industrial base, covering the entire province of Jiangsu.

LTE-V2X Internet of Vehicles applications from theory to practice

Internationally, Huawei and Datang as the main rapporteurs submitted a standard application for the Internet of Vehicles (LTE-V2X) to the international communications standards organization 3GPP, and officially established the first international standard in 2017. Afterwards, 5GAA was established as an international organization across the telecommunications and automotive industries at the end of 2016, and has successively completed the release of the Internet of Vehicles (LTE-V2X) industry roadmap. It has formulated a full-chain industry specification from commercial use cases, network architecture to application platforms. As of April 2018, there were 84 member units, including 12 directors including China Mobile, Huawei, Audi, Ford, Intel, Vodafone, and telecommunications operators such as China Unicom, Deutsche Telekom, AT & T, and Japan docomo. Including Bosch, Continental, Denso and other top automotive suppliers.

As we all know, LTE-V2X is one of the main technical means for the realization of Internet of Vehicles applications. It integrates LTE mobile broadband and V2X direct connection technology. Through the Internet of Vehicles platform to achieve data and application communication, it can provide better people-vehicles. -Road-cloud collaboration and user experience. Compared with the traditional V2X technology, LTE-V2X has a wider propagation distance, shorter delay and greater communication capability, especially the reliability of multi-vehicle communication in high-density scenarios has been greatly improved, solving many traditional methods. The problem of limited capacity in vehicle scenarios; on the other hand, with the optimized mobile broadband network, LTE-V2X can freely connect to the Internet anytime, anywhere, and provide cloud and network collaboration with open data capabilities, such as road condition monitoring, remote warning, and information push. And other applications.

In the recent period, Audi, BMW, Mercedes-Benz, Peugeot Citroen, Bosch, Continental and other auto industry companies have extensively developed Internet of Vehicles (LTE-V2X) with Vodafone, Deutsche Telekom, Deutsche Telekom, France Docomo, AT & T in Europe, Japan, and the United States. Test verification and external display have further promoted the maturity of the technology and the rapid development of the industry.

What is the significance of the demonstration project?

As the world's first city-level vehicle-road collaboration platform, the Internet of Vehicles (LTE-V2X) urban-level demonstration application major project has the following important significance after its completion in Wuxi:

1. LTE-V2X is China's leading wireless communication technology with independent intellectual property rights, and faces the future evolution of 5G-based Internet of Vehicles wireless communication technology;

2. As the only way for assisted driving to move towards autonomous driving, LTE-V2X technology has the ability to support advanced automatic driving, human-vehicle collaborative perception and control, and promote the construction of a more efficient and collaborative intelligent transportation system through the construction of a car networking platform. To make the road smarter and the car easier to run;

3. Attract the majority of motorists and drivers to actively participate in it. While promoting the convenience of smart transportation, it also contributes valuable traffic big data and continuously optimizes the intelligent driving experience.

Fourth, as a new generation of information technology for future smart transportation and Internet of Vehicles / Internet of Things, deep integration with industrial Internet, artificial intelligence, video surveillance, and cloud computing will provide more possibilities for exploration and development.

At present, in addition to the core sponsors, the first companies participating in the project include Audi China, China FAW, Ford, Changan Automobile, Volvo, Zotye Automobile, Guanzhi Automobile, Neusoft, Intel, Peugeot Citroen, Gaode Map, Dongfeng Motor . In the future, the project will continue to attract more industrial partners to participate in it. The major application demonstration projects will plan to complete the commercial launch of 13 major application scenarios, including traffic light information push / traffic speed guidance, and road traffic congestion reminders.
